Cameron LNG LLC is Hiring a Safety Engineer Near Hackberry, LA

 

Primary Purpose:

The role of the Safety Engineer is to provide development and oversight of the health and safety programs based upon HSSE Cameron LNG Guidelines. Develops and maintains good communication, presentation and interpersonal skills that help operations and other functional groups implement those process changes or procedures necessary to comply with the regulations and requirements. Facilitates the writing or writes site safety procedures and helps communicate/train on any changes or additions. Provides safety support to all departments as needed. The Safety Engineer will report to the Safety Supervisor. 

This position will be located in Hackberry, Louisiana. Transportation Worker Identification Credentials (TWIC) will be required.

Responsibilities:

  • Assists with the review, revision and development of all the health and safety programs 

  • Develops and delivers training to the site for safety issues: Develops training materials pertaining to safety issues as required by the site due to new or changing Federal or State regulations.

  • Provides the training materials to the parties responsible for delivering site training or may deliver the training directly to the site employees.

  • Works with Operations organization to implement processes to meet regulatory requirements and ensure operating flexibility.

  • Reviews the work of others to ensure compliance with applicable federal, state, local, and departmental, procedures, regulations, guidelines, and standards 

  • Develops and maintains a working knowledge of the site and processes.

  • Reduces safety costs through the implementation of Best Practices at the site.

  • Performs other duties as assigned

DOT Requirements:

The U.S Department of Transportation (DOT) and the company have adopted regulations governing the control of drug use by persons in certain job classifications. This position is subject to the Federal Pipelines Regulation; and is stipulated in the 49 Code of Federal Regulations (CFR) part 40 that requires drug and alcohol testing and must meet the testing standards.
